Sarah Flieder has lived in central Topeka for the past six years and used to have easy access to groceries. That was before the Dillons store near her house closed in 2016. "The closest place now is the Dollar General on 10th street," she said. "That is quite a bit of a walk." Flieder and other Topekans in the area could have some relief if the Central Topeka Grocery Oasis Group has its way. The group, which has advocated for central Topeka's grocery store needs in recent years, is working with GraceMed to try to build a store next to its building at S.W. 12th Street and Washburn Avenue.
